Invitation to the Federal Ministry of Defense

In June 2023, we had a meeting lasting several hours with the PTSD coordinator, Surgeon General Dr. Ahrens.

The occasion was our list of demands, the content of which includes suggestions for improving the care of deployed veterans and their families, including an amendment/expansion of the Deployment Continuation Act, so that former professional soldiers who have voluntarily left the service can begin their medical and/or vocational rehabilitation under the protection and social security of their employer.

    Bundestag vote on national veterans' day

    National Veterans Day is coming! June 15th of every year. What a development! Thank you to all our supporters, pioneers, and the Veterans Policy Working Group. For us as an association, in addition to the introduction of this day, it is absolutely crucial that the care, appreciation, and recognition of the families and relatives of traumatized/injured service members are recognized and, above all, improved. Because much more than just a day in June depends on this decision; it will improve support, reduce bureaucracy, and involve and protect families. Career soldiers who have resigned due to despair and illness will also be included in the Disability Compensation Act (EinsWVG) in the future and can return to the Bundeswehr (German Armed Forces) and begin their recovery with care and security.     Closing event/panel discussion

    "Serving Germany?" - 70 years of the German Armed Forces: Job or calling


    The perception of the profession of "soldier in the German Armed Forces" has changed dramatically in Germany over the past 70 years. This transformation is closely linked to the political, social, and security policy developments of the Federal Republic of Germany. Currently, public opinion regarding the military profession seems to fluctuate between pronounced skepticism and pragmatic acceptance. While the German Armed Forces are now recognized as essential for security policy, societal identification with the military profession remains limited—especially compared to other countries with a strong military culture, such as the USA or France.
